The capital repair of the Plaza del Mercado, a property erected in 1921 under the aegis of the famous architect José Lecticio Salcines, is at 20 percent completion, said Katiuska Saburén, principal specialist in the productive area of the Provincial Construction Enterprise.
Some forty men of the Guantanamo Base Business Unit work in two of the four sale areas foreseen in the project, in the completion of the kiosks and the reinforcement of original beams and columns in one of these areas and the construction of new sale areas in the second.
They also work on the restoration of the facade of eclectic style that includes several stone decorations and the three sculptural sets inspired by Greco-Roman mythology and made by the Spanish master builder José María Cantalapiedra.
Meanwhile, a cement mixture was applied in one of the remaining sections of the roof that was waterproofed, and it is planned to demolish a second slab seriously damaged by the leaks after the collapse of the original systems for rainwater drainage.
Finally the enterprise's board of directors explained that they have guaranteed the technology, trained personnel and the necessary materials for the execution of the work, which began in February and the completion date is scheduled for December 2019.
